Philanthropy etymologically means "the love of humanity"—love in the sense of caring for, nourishing, developing, or enhancing; humanity in the sense of "what it is to be human," or "human potential." In modern practical terms, it is "private initiatives for public good, focusing on quality of life"
A significant donor interest in our school, and a sustainable practice seen in many long-term Catholic school institutions, is the development of an endowment from which a consistent yield is applied to tuition assistance or aid.
Currently St. Thomas More is blessed with an endowment that supplies partial funding into our tuition assistance system and general operations.
